Army jawan dies of swine flu in Jammu

An army jawan posted at the Akhnoor-based Crossed Swords Division died of swine flu today.
"Soldier Havildar Dangar Bavan Danabhai, who was serving under Crossed Swords Division, died of swine flu at the Military Hospital, Satwari today," Jammu-based defense spokesman Lt Col Manish Mehta said.
He said the soldier was admitted in the military hospital on February 14 after he tested positive for H1N1 virus.
"His test reports for the virus were positive. He breathed his last early today morning," Mehta said.
